Initiated by Solidus Labs, a crypto risk management and trading monitoring company, a group of major crypto companies including Huobi TechCircle, and Anchorage Digital has launched the Crypto Market Integrity Coalition (CMIC). 

The group said the launch of the CMIC is an industry-defining commitment focused on fostering a fair digital asset market to combat market abuse and manipulation, as well as increase public and regulator confidence in this new asset class. 

The alliance currently has 17 founding members, including CrossTower, BitMex, GSR, Bitstamp, Elwood, CryptoCompare, Securrency, MV Index Solutions, the Chamber of Digital Commerce, Global Digital Finance, CryptoUK, and more.
